1985 Volkswagen Caravelle — MOT failures & pass rate

The 1985 Volkswagen Caravelle passed 71.1% of its 2,119 recorded MOT tests. MPVs of a similar age fail at 28.2%, so the 1985 Caravelle sits squarely on the average. Failures cluster in lighting & signalling, suspension and brakes.

What the MOT record shows

Lighting & signalling dominates the failure mix at 17.0% of all tests — 4.0 points clear of suspension, so it is the first thing to check.

At component level the recurring items are component mounting prescribed areas, headlamp aim and headlamp — component mounting prescribed areas alone was recorded 223 times.

Mileage matters less than usual here: the 1985 Caravelle fails 28.3% of the time in the 0-30k band and 31.6% at 150k+, a spread of only 3.3 points.

Advisories point at the next bill rather than this one: suspension was flagged on 37.6% of tests without failing them.
